Kinds Of Glass Damage
When handling broken glass, it's essential to determine the type of damage one is dealing with. The repair technique will depend upon this classification. Below is a table summarizing typical types of glass damage and their prospective repair solutions.
Kind Of Glass DamageDescriptionPossible Repair MethodsCracksHairline or larger fissures in the glassEpoxy resin, glass adhesiveChipsSmall pieces missing out on from the edge of the glassClear adhesive, glass fillerShattered GlassGlass that is gotten into lots of piecesReplacement, professional repairScratchesSurface abrasions on the glassPolishing substances, buffing strategiesFoggy Glass Replacement or Dirty GlassAn accumulation of dirt or moisture in double panesProfessional cleaning or seal replacementTypical Types of Glass and Their Repairs
Comprehending the type of glass you are dealing with is important for effective repair. The following table lays out common types of glass and their appropriate repair methods.
Kind of GlassAttributesRepair TechniqueTempered GlassHeat-treated for strength; shatters into small piecesReplacement justLaminated GlassTwo layers held together with a plastic interlayerProfessional repair to replace layersAnnealed GlassStandard glass; can crack or break easilyEpoxy for small cracks, replacement for extreme damagePlexiglassResilient plastic alternative to glassAcrylic cement for bondingDo It Yourself Repair Methods
For minor damages like chips and cracks, numerous homeowners may choose DIY repair solutions. Here's a summary of some reliable approaches to deal with broken glass repair:
1. For Cracks:Epoxy Resin: This strong adhesive can be applied to fractures to bond the glass together. First, clean the location, use the resin, and enable it to treat based on the manufacturer's directions.2. For Chips:Clear Adhesive or Glass Filler: Fill the chip with a clear adhesive or glass filler. This method works best for small chips. As soon as dry, sand it down for a smooth surface.3. For Scratches:Polishing Compound: A basic polishing substance can often eliminate shallow scratches. Apply the compound with a soft fabric and buff till the scratch diminishes.4. For Foggy Double-Pane Glass:Seal Replacement: Unfortunately, this typically requires a professional, as disassembling the window is needed to properly tidy and reseal the glass.5. For Shattered Glass:Replacement: Typically, when Misty Glass Repair is shattered, the safest alternative is to change the entire unit. Attempting to repair shattered glass is typically not practical and can posture safety dangers.When to Call a Professional

Q2: What materials are safe to utilize for glass repair?
A2: Common repair products consist of epoxy resin, clear adhesive, and glass filler, all of which can supply effective bonding for minor damages.
Q3: How do I clean glass before repairing it?
A3: Use a glass cleaner or a mixture of water and vinegar to clean the area thoroughly before using any repair materials.
Q4: Is it worth it to repair small chips?
A4: Yes, repairing minor chips can avoid additional cracking and enhance the appearance of the glass, making it a rewarding financial investment.
